WASHINGTON CO. APPRAISAL DISTRICT BOARD TO HOLD BUDGET WORKSHOP

  

The Washington County Appraisal District Board of Directors will discuss the appraisal district’s budget for the upcoming fiscal year at its meeting on Tuesday.

The proposed 2025-26 budget is $1,903,610, an increase of $215,635 from the current adopted budget.  Contributing to the higher budget is an extra $153,000 listed for personnel costs, $55,735 in additional professional and contracted services, and $6,900 in other new operating costs.

The second budget workshop is scheduled for March 25th.  The board will hold a public hearing and potentially adopt the budget at its meeting on April 22nd.

After Tuesday’s workshop, board members will consider adopting a revised board of director’s policy manual before hearing monthly reports.

The board will meet Tuesday at 10 a.m. at the appraisal district office in Brenham at 1301 Niebuhr Street.
